Hello plugin authors,

Next Thursday, Corbexa will run a disaster-recovery drill for the RestockRoute vending-machine restock planner. During the failover window, plugin callbacks will be replayed against the standby scheduler, so please ensure your handlers are idempotent and tolerate duplicate route assignments. No customer restock data will be altered. To re-register your plugin against the standby environment during the drill, authenticate with the recovery passphrase provided below.

vault phrase of hahip-tajeg = quenax-briath-briax

The Glyphsort service sniffs uploaded text files before handing them to plugins. Detection order: BOM check, then statistical analysis via the Charwarden library, then fallback to `UPLOAD_DEFAULT_ENCODING` (ship it as `utf-8` unless a tenant demands otherwise). Plugins receive normalized UTF-8 only; never re-detect downstream. Set `ENCODING_STRICT=1` to reject ambiguous files instead of guessing. Charwarden phones the model registry at boot, so the env file must include the registry credential on the next line:

sealed setting: ARCHIVE_KEY3=8d0

Q: The landlord (Ostrever Holdings) is auditing the Kellanby Court site next week — what do we do? A: Audit runs Tuesday–Thursday, ground floor and plant rooms only. Escort the assessors at all times; no photos in the server corridor. Log each entry in the visit book. To admit them through the rear service door, use the code below.

staff pass of kawip-hawef = bdg-QLP-2